Pureprofile sees 61% lift in revenue as momentum continues into new financial year

ASX-listed research and media company Pureprofile has reported a sharp rise in revenue in the first quarter of the 2022 financial year as its chief executive flagged accelerated expansion beyond Australia.

Revenue hit $10.2 million in the three months to September, up 61% on the previous corresponding period.

Earnings climbed 29% to $1.1 million, while its existing partnerships data volume increased 42% on the previous quarter.
